I actually can't play my 2 competitive lists in 8th edition.

My Skyhammer list is no longer legal, considering half the units must start on the table.

Also, centurions cannot ride in pods, and that was a component in my other one.

But that's okay, i found these kinds of lists produced fairly one sided games.
